Winchendon Approves $300k Buyout of Town Manager’s Contract
The agreement — reached with “guidance and advice” from the town’s labor and employment attorney — said that selectmen have determined there is “no cause” for his termination and therefore, must offer him a buyout to avoid a “protracted and costly” legal battle that could expose the town to a wrongful termination suit that could cost more than $2 million plus legal fees.
